内容介绍:
在数字系统中,二进制是一种使用两个数字(0和1)表示数值的数制。将十进制小数转换为二进制是一个常见的问题,尤其是在计算机科学和电子工程领域。下面我们将详细介绍如何将十进制小数7.943转换为二进制表示。
转换步骤
1. 整数部分转换:
将十进制整数部分7转换为二进制。7的二进制表示为111。
2. 小数部分转换:
对于小数部分0.943,我们需要重复乘以2,并取整数部分作为二进制表示的一位。
0.943 2 = 1.886,取整数部分1,二进制表示的第一位为1。
0.886 2 = 1.772,取整数部分1,二进制表示的第二位为1。
0.772 2 = 1.544,取整数部分1,二进制表示的第三位为1。
0.544 2 = 1.088,取整数部分1,二进制表示的第四位为1。
0.088 2 = 0.176,取整数部分0,二进制表示的第五位为0。
0.176 2 = 0.352,取整数部分0,二进制表示的第六位为0。
0.352 2 = 0.704,取整数部分0,二进制表示的第七位为0。
0.704 2 = 1.408,取整数部分1,二进制表示的第八位为1。
3. 组合结果:
将整数部分和转换后的小数部分组合起来,得到7.943的二进制表示为111.11100100。
因此,十进制小数7.943转换为二进制表示为111.11100100。在实际应用中,根据需要可能需要截断小数部分或者继续计算,直到达到所需的精度。
发表回复
评论列表(0条)